Kids Bike Size Chart

When it comes to choosing the right bike for your child, it is important to take into account their size and weight. To help with this, the following bike size chart has been created.

Wheel sizeAgeHeightInseam
12”2-32’10”-3’4”14-17” 35-42 cm
14”3-43’1”-3’7”16-20” 40-50 cm
16”4-53’7”-4’0”18-22” 45-55 cm
18”5-63’9”-4’3”20-24” 50-60 cm
20”5-84’0”-4’5”22-25” 55-63 cm
24”7-114’5”-4’9”24-28” 60-72 cm
